Directions
-
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) if you’re planning to bake or reheat the assembled sandwiches. This step ensures that the final result is warm and delightful.
-
In a bowl, whisk together the eggs, milk, salt, and pepper to taste. This mixture creates smooth and creamy scrambled eggs that are essential for your sandwich.
-
Next, heat the butter in a skillet over medium heat. Once the butter starts to foam, pour in the egg mixture. Stir continuously until the eggs are fully cooked to your liking, achieving that tremendous fluffiness.
-
While the eggs are cooking, slice the croissants in half lengthwise. If desired, lightly toast them for an added crunch, enhancing the sandwich’s texture.
-
Now it’s time to assemble your sandwiches. Take the bottom half of each croissant and place a slice of cheddar cheese on it. Follow this with a generous scoop of the scrambled eggs and top it off with a slice of bacon or a sausage patty.
-
Gently place the top half of the croissant over the layered filling. Press down slightly to secure all the components.
-
Serve the sandwiches immediately for the best experience, or you can wrap them individually in foil and freeze for later enjoyment.
-
To reheat your frozen sandwiches, simply bake at 350°F for 10–15 minutes, or microwave for 1–2 minutes until heated through. Enjoy the tremendous flavors all over again!
